Support us on the Patreons! In this episode we discuss an article that found that being confident after ACLR was a factor for increased risk of 2nd ACL injury. Confidence, ability to meet return to sport criteria, and second ACL injury risk associations after ACL‐reconstruction. Mark V Paterno, Staci Thomas, Karen Thatcher VanEtten, Laura C Schmitt. J Orthop Res. 2021 Apr 30. doi: 10.1002/jor.25071. Online ahead of print.
